Our first Happy Hour! With 50 States of Soccer: Wisconsin in full swing, The Committee is joined by Green Bay, Wisconsin soccer legend Jay DeMerit. The former USMNT defender recaps his past career from youth soccer to playing abroad as he found his own path to the Premier League. His Hallowed Grounds and Five-a-Side selections to finish the week of Wisconsin out.
